Title: Frederich Grosz: Innovator in Pomegranate Seed Extraction
Introduction
Frederich Grosz is a notable inventor based in Holon, Israel. He has made significant contributions to agricultural technology, particularly in the field of fruit processing. His innovative approach has led to the development of a unique apparatus designed to enhance the efficiency of extracting pomegranate seeds.
Latest Patents
Grosz holds a patent for an "Apparatus and method for extracting pomegranate seeds from pomegranates." This invention includes a pomegranate breaker that operates to break open pomegranates without cutting the seeds inside. Additionally, it features a seed extractor that effectively separates the seeds from the other parts of the fruit. This invention is particularly valuable for improving the processing of pomegranates, which are known for their delicious seeds.
Career Highlights
Frederich Grosz is affiliated with the State of Israel's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development, specifically at the Agricultural Research Organization, Volcani Center. His work there focuses on advancing agricultural practices and technologies that benefit the agricultural sector.
Collaborations
Grosz has collaborated with esteemed colleagues such as Ze'ev Schmilovitch and Yoav Sarig. Their combined expertise contributes to the innovative research and development efforts at the Volcani Center.
